Is This Your Company?
Ajilon Canada Inc
Address:
10025 102a Ave Nw Suite 1824
Edmonton, AB , T5J 2Z2 This company is located in the Mountain Time Zone and the office is currently
Open
Get a Free Quote from Ajilon Canada Inc and other companies Ajilon Canada Inc
|
Products - National | Products - Local |